Get to know the compassionate souls who lead our congregation from the heart and by the book.
Brent Missildine is the Pulpit Minister for the Prattville Church of Christ.
Jason Green is the Youth Minister, working with the Prattville Church of Christ Teens.
John Mark Stephenson is the Young Adult Minister and working with the Prattville Church of Christ Young Adult Class.
Get to know group of individuals who serve as the guiding lights of Prattville Church of Christ.
Reggie Brown has been a resident of Prattville since 1984. Serving as an elder since 2010, he and his wife, Valera, are proud parents to two children.
David Erfman has served as an elder at Prattville for over two decades. David and Virginia are proud parents to two adult children, who are both active members of the church.
Marvin Gentry has been a member of this church since childhood, serving in various roles and as an elder for over two decades.
David Hall he has been a resident of Prattville since 1987. David served as a deacon overseeing various ministries before becoming an Elder at Prattville in September 2019.
Sammy, a member since 1994, became an elder in 2019 after serving as a deacon overseeing children's education and the Lads to Leaders program.
Neal and his wife, Donna, met at Oklahoma Christian College and were married in 1971. He has been honored to serve as an elder at Prattville since 2008.
